Main Ingredients
Here's the lowdown on the must-haves. Pay attention to quality – it seriously matters. I remember once using cheap cream cheese and the whole thing tasted...off. Lesson learned!
Graham Cracker Crust:
- 1 ½ cups (150g) graham cracker crumbs.
- 5 tablespoons (70g) unsalted butter, melted. Quality indicators: real butter.
- ¼ cup (50g) granulated sugar.
- Pinch of salt.
Cheesecake Filling:
- 32 ounces (900g) cream cheese, softened. Quality indicators: Use Philadelphia!
- 1 ¾ cups (350g) granulated sugar.
- 2 teaspoons vanilla extract.
- ¼ teaspoon salt.
- 4 large eggs, at room temperature.
- ¾ cup (175ml) heavy cream, at room temperature. This is essential for creaminess.
- 2 tablespoons sour cream, at room temperature.

Prep Like a Pro: Your Cheesecake Mise en Place
First things first, get organized! it's all about the mise en place , that fancy chef term for having everything ready.
Get your ingredients measured out. soften that cream cheese properly . we're talking room temperature, people! it prevents lumps. i learned that the hard way.
.. once made a cheesecake with lumpy cream cheese. disaster. also, remember to soften the eggs and sour cream, this will make a more smooth cheesecake.
Now, time-saving tip: crush those graham crackers in a food processor. makes life easier. another tip is to prepare your springform pan by wrapping it tightly in foil.
This prevents water from leaking in during the water bath.
Step-by-Step to Cheesecake Bliss: Easy To Make Cheesecake
Alright, here’s how to make Philadelphia cheesecake , or a close approximation. It's easier than you think, I swear.
- Crust Time! Mix 1 ½ cups graham cracker crumbs, 5 tablespoons melted butter, ¼ cup sugar. Press into your springform pan. Chill it for 30 minutes.
- Cream Cheese Magic! Beat 32 ounces softened cream cheese and 1 ¾ cups sugar until fluffy. No lumps allowed!
- Egg-cellent Addition! Add 4 large eggs one at a time, mixing well after each addition. Don't overmix . We don’t want cracks.
- Creamy Dream! Stir in ¾ cup heavy cream and 2 tablespoons sour cream.
- Water Bath Time! Wrap the pan with foil. Pour the filling into the crust. Put the pan in a larger roasting pan and add hot water to halfway up the sides.
- Bake It! Bake at 325° F ( 160° C) for 60- 75 minutes . It should be slightly jiggly in the center.
- Cool Down! Turn off the oven, crack the door, and let it cool for 1 hour. Then, cool at room temperature.
- Chill Out! Refrigerate for at least 4 hours (overnight is better).

Frequently Asked Questions
Why did my cheesecake crack, and how to make cheesecake without cracks?
Cracking is a common cheesecake woe, like a soggy bottom on a Great British Baking Show pie! It's often caused by rapid temperature changes or overbaking. Using a water bath helps regulate the temperature and humidity, ensuring even baking. Also, cool the cheesecake slowly in the oven with the door ajar for an hour, then at room temperature before refrigerating. This gradual cooling is key!
Can I make cheesecake ahead of time?
Absolutely! In fact, cheesecake is often better when made ahead. Refrigerating it overnight allows the flavors to meld and the texture to set completely. Just be sure to store it properly, tightly wrapped in plastic wrap or in an airtight container, to prevent it from drying out or absorbing other fridge odors. Like a fine wine, cheesecake often improves with a little aging!
How do I store leftover cheesecake?
Leftover cheesecake should be stored in the refrigerator, tightly wrapped in plastic wrap or in an airtight container. This will keep it fresh for up to 5 days. You can also freeze cheesecake for longer storage (up to 2 months). Thaw it in the refrigerator overnight before serving for best results, avoiding that "freezer burn" flavour.
What if I don't have a springform pan, can I still learn how to make cheesecake?
While a springform pan is ideal, you can make cheesecake without one. Line a regular cake pan with parchment paper, leaving enough overhang to lift the cheesecake out after baking. However, removing the cheesecake can be a bit tricky, so handle it with care! If you're serious about cheesecake, investing in a springform pan is worth it.
My cheesecake is too tangy. How can I adjust the flavor?
The tang often comes from the cream cheese or sour cream. If it's too strong for your liking, try using a slightly sweeter cream cheese variety or reduce the amount of sour cream. Adding a touch more vanilla extract can also help balance the flavors. Like Goldilocks, you want the tang to be just right, not too much, not too little!
Can I make a gluten-free cheesecake?
Yes! Simply substitute the graham cracker crust with a gluten-free alternative. You can use gluten-free graham crackers or make a crust using almond flour or other gluten-free cookie crumbs. Ensure all other ingredients are also gluten-free to avoid cross-contamination. Then you can tuck into your gluten free cheesecake with the best of them!
